Choosing the right Floor Plan for a Log Home

One of the biggest decisions that clients will have to make when determining what the layout of their new log home will be, is the final floor plan that they choose. We try to simplify these decisions by assisting in the final layout. We currently carry a number of different models on our website to assist clients in getting the process started. These designs are not written in stone, they can be altered in anyway imaginable so that the dimensions of the rooms can be adjusted to fit the lifestyles of the clients. Any design, in any design book can be converted into log construction without any issues or concerns, as our designers and engineers can make any structural alterations, if required. For most of the log homes that we construct, the clients have found a floor plan in a conventional construction plan book.
